Transaction 20c3e43ac0481429663c1497a0359758b209f4203064f6676990aaa085958106

5 Input
2 Outputs
  • 20c3e43ac0481429663c1497a0359758b209f4203064f6676990aaa085958106:0
  • value  18403
    address  1PiKpgvDJpMm4RuFb7d9RwfwndJ5kPH116
  • 20c3e43ac0481429663c1497a0359758b209f4203064f6676990aaa085958106:1
  • value  395759
    address  3QxKgeuPVXr7Eh5ZvpRpKa3V78gQheWuSG